aparently no joke i chatted to a guy who works in a game shop and he says its better on pc than xbox

That makes sense. After all...

1. It looks better on the PC thanks to improved textures and the possibility of higher resolutions like 1900x1200.

2. Mouse aiming has apparently been implemented perfectly and makes pulling of headshots easier.

3. The online play is free.

4. The game itself is cheaper.

5. You get 5 additional levels.

and 6. You get to fight the Brumak in the pc version.
